Summary

A US federal research program funds research into combustion processes, fire dynamics, and related thermal systems with applications to energy, safety, and environmental challenges. The program is open to academic researchers and institutions conducting fundamental and applied research in combustion science and fire safety.

About this grant

The Combustion and Fire Systems program is part of the Transport Phenomena cluster within the NSF and aims to create new knowledge to support advances in clean energy, climate change mitigation, a cleaner environment, and public safety. The program focuses on creating fundamental scientific knowledge needed for safe, clean, and useful combustion applications and for mitigating the effects of fire. …
